Serving 463 students in grades Kindergarten-6, Roseland Creek Elementary School ranks in the bottom 50% of all schools in California for overall test scores (math proficiency is bottom 50%, and reading proficiency is bottom 50%).
The percentage of students achieving proficiency in math is 14% (which is lower than the California state average of 33%). The percentage of students achieving proficiency in reading/language arts is 25% (which is lower than the California state average of 47%).
The student:teacher ratio of 21:1 is equal to the California state level of 21:1.
Minority enrollment is 96%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is higher than the California state average of 80% (majority Hispanic).

School Overview

Roseland Creek Elementary School's student population of 463 students has grown by 26% over five school years.
The teacher population of 22 teachers has grown by 29% over five school years.
